    Xbox One wireless controller suddenly not working with Win10


    Problem:

    - Xbox One wireless controller now listed in Device Manager as "Unknown USB Device Device Descriptor Request Failed"


    System:

    Edition: Windows 10 Pro

    Version: 20H2

    Build: 19042.685

    Experience: Windows Feature Experience Pack 120.2212.551.0


    Steps taken to solve the problem:

    - Restart computer multiple times

    - Tried without USB cable, plugged the receiver directly in to an USB port

    - Uninstall controller in Device Manager, then reconnected controller. Devices is re-added with same error message: "Unknown USB Device Device Descriptor Request Failed"

    Under devmgmt.msc I tried to remove the unknow USB, but when I plugged the USB back in it is the same, tried to reboot after removing the USB but that does not fix the problem either.

    I would also suggest you to uninstall all the hidden devices under USB hive and check if you are able to connect the wireless adapter. Please follow the steps mentioned below to uninstall the hidden drivers:



    1. Press and hold the Windows + X key on the keyboard.
    2. Select Device manager.
    3. Click View tab.
    4. Select Show hidden devices.
    5. Expand Universal Serial Bus and remove all the greyed out devices. To remove the greyed out devices, right click on the device and select
      uninstall.
    6. Restart your computer.

    You will be asked for a PIN when connecting your wireless Xbox One controller via Bluetooth on Windows 10 if your Bluetooth drivers are not updated. It is also possible that you have to reset the controller to remove the PIN. To resolve your concern, restart
    your controller by following the steps below:

    • Power off the controller by pressing and holding the Xbox button on the controller for 6 seconds.
    • Press the Xbox button again to power it back on.
    • Connect your Xbox Wireless Controller to your PC using a USB cable or the Xbox Wireless Adapter for Windows.
